Output f159da4aefbbc2629c2e186960b32cef5247973a476e05789b8dfe8a7eedbc73:1

value
12185725
script pubkey
OP_0 OP_PUSHBYTES_20 39c43aff50f959dfa4efa51e884024774df71a9f
address
bc1q88zr4l6sl9valf80550gsspywaxlwx5lwxps20
transaction
f159da4aefbbc2629c2e186960b32cef5247973a476e05789b8dfe8a7eedbc73
confirmations
109242
spent
true